Today I am showcasing a mixed media card  using my newly released Border Stamp "Brush Flower" #234, from AALLandCreate. Our stockists can be found HERE.
I love mixing stamps and stencils with paints and textural elements and this simple cards shows all these elements perfectly. I began by brayering light layers of paint onto my white card, beginning with Lemon, then Tangerine and then onto Magenta, using only the smallest amount of paint.
I have added just touches of stencilling using Stencil 50 along with some background stamping using Picked Raspberry Distress Oxide Ink.
I brayered the paints lightly across my card and if you brayer whilst the paints are still wet you achieve a seamless blend.
I incorporated a touch of doodling to draw the eye into the focal image.

Today I am showcasing an accordion using my newly released A7 Stamps "Magical House" and "Heart and Home" #261 and #263 combined with my newly released Border Stamp "Brush Flower" #234, from AALLandCreate. Our stockists can be found HERE.
I love creating mini accordions and this time around I have used Cracked Pistachio and Peacock Feathers in the background, adding the inks to my non-stick craft sheet and then mopping up the colours with the pieces of card. Repeating the process several times to achieve good depth of colour.
I then coloured a separate piece of white card with Carved Pumpkin and Picked Raspberry and then stamped my little houses onto the coloured card. I also added some background stamping using the number background stamp from my "Brush  Flower" Border Stamp.
Once piece of the accordion was also stamped with the sentiments within the sets along with the little adorable fairy. I also used Gel Pens to add colourful highlights.
A few touches of doodling and white highlights add further detail.
Sentiments have also been stamped onto calico for added texture.
I added black twine to act as closures for my accordion.

Today I am showcasing a mixed media card  using my newly released Border Stamp "Brush Flower" #234, from AALLandCreate. Our stockists can be found HERE.
I am so thrilled with this stamp, the detail is fantastic and the background elements really add so much interest to the design.

I am loving using embroidery hoops in my artwork and this smaller size worked perfectly for my card.
This picture shows the detail in the background and also the added layer from the Lotza Dotz Stencil. I used Distress Oxides Fossilized Amber and Hickory Smoke, a new favourite colour palette for me at the moment.
I used a resist technique in the background and then added my inks, applying the inks to a piece of Acetate and then smooshing the ink across the card.
I love adding some touches of hand stitching to my designs, it adds a wonderful textural element.
Of course I had to add some random book pages to the background along with some delicate splatters of paint.
